benoxathian and Neuralgia

benoxathian has been researched along with Neuralgia in 1 studies

benoxathian: RN given refers to parent cpd; structure given in first source

Neuralgia: Intense or aching pain that occurs along the course or distribution of a peripheral or cranial nerve.
